The Coilcraft 0402CS-16NXGLW is a fixed inductor belonging to the 0402 package size category. It offers a nominal inductance of 16nH with a tight tolerance of 2%. This component is rated for a maximum DC current of 560mA and has a DC resistance of 220mOhm. Its self-resonant frequency is 3.1GHz, and it achieves a Q factor of 47 at 250MHz.
The inductor is constructed with a ceramic material and features SMD/SMT termination, making it suitable for surface-mount technology. Its dimensions are 1.19mm in length, 640µm in width, and 660µm in height. The component is RoHS3 compliant and considered lead-free.
This inductor is designed for applications requiring precise inductance values in a compact form factor. Its electrical characteristics make it suitable for various electronic circuits where filtering or energy storage is needed.
